Happy New Year! It’s time for new tires. I have a JLU Rubicon with a 2” lift. Moving from 33s to 35s … looking for some feedback on the Patagonia X/Ts… also considering Nitto Ridge Grapplers and the Toyo Open Country. I’m in FL so no major rock crawling just beach and trails. The Jeep sees mostly road driving. I would appreciate the group’s feedback. Thanks!

I'm running the cooper discovery at3 XLT in 37's and I've been very happy with them. They took us all the way to Alaska and back this summer and do well on the highway. They do well in the snow (not a big issue for you! Lol) but also seems to do well in the wet too! I'd definitely give them a look.

There is another variable.

My new tyres are 30mm wider than the stock tyre. More rubber on the ground means better grip off road.

But on road, there is a minor penalty in fuel consumption. And when driving the tyres have a softness the old tyres did not have, probably due to the width.
